Output 0758bcf34633a4dac71b9e419adcd2b85213e5bde914bf193a3f70bbc06bba63:3

value
10997753321
script pubkey
OP_0 OP_PUSHBYTES_32 f2557d17b2529b25aa495ac37fa4e778dcb9ceba683cdc33a2c8d2000cf6fb3d
address
bc1q7f2h69aj22djt2jfttphlf880rwtnn46dq7dcvazerfqqr8klv7s3hgtg9
transaction
0758bcf34633a4dac71b9e419adcd2b85213e5bde914bf193a3f70bbc06bba63
confirmations
93610
spent
true